Binary package hint: gnome-settings-daemon
My Sony Vaio laptop has two extra keys for launching applications,
marked "S1" and "S2". The operating system recognizes them as I can
assign these keys to functions with "System" -> "Preferences" ->
"Keyboard Shortcuts". For example I click on "Launch e-mail client" and
then the name of the selected shortcut turns to "New shortcut...". Then
I press <S1> and this gets recognized as the name of the shortcuts turns
to "XF86Launch1" then. <S2> gives "XF86Launch2". After closing the
dialog and I press the <S1> and <S2> keys and nothing happens. The
assigned applications do not get started.
